H2: Understanding Lowe's ComeService

Lowe's ComeService is their in-home appliance repair program. They partner with independent service providers to offer repair services for a wide range of major appliances, including refrigerators, washing machines, dryers, ovens, and dishwashers. This isn't a direct service from Lowe's employees; it's a network of vetted technicians.

H2: What to Expect from Lowe's ComeService

  • Scheduling: Scheduling a repair typically involves contacting Lowe's either online or by phone. You'll need your appliance's model number and a brief description of the problem. Availability can vary depending on location and technician schedules.
  • Technicians: Lowe's vets their technicians, but the quality of service can vary. Customer reviews highlight both positive and negative experiences. Some praise the professionalism and expertise of the technicians, while others report delays, inaccurate diagnoses, or subpar repairs.
  • Pricing: Repair costs aren't fixed. They depend on the appliance, the issue, and the parts required. Expect a service fee plus the cost of any necessary parts. It's recommended to ask for a price estimate before the technician arrives, though this isn't always possible.
  • Warranty: While Lowe's offers warranties on appliances purchased from them, the warranty usually doesn't extend to ComeService repairs themselves. However, the parts used in the repair might have their own warranties. Check your appliance's documentation and any repair invoices carefully.

H2: Advantages of Using Lowe's ComeService

  • Convenience: Scheduling a repair through a familiar retailer like Lowe's can be convenient. The process is often straightforward and easily accessible online.
  • Accessibility: Lowe's has a widespread presence, making it relatively easy to find a technician in many areas.
  • Potential Savings: Depending on the issue, a repair might be more cost-effective than replacing the appliance entirely. Getting a quote is vital before proceeding.

H2: Disadvantages of Using Lowe's ComeService

  • Variable Quality: As mentioned, the quality of service can be inconsistent. The technician's skill and professionalism can vary significantly. Reading online reviews beforehand can help manage expectations.
  • Pricing Transparency: Pricing can be unclear upfront. You might receive a price quote, but unexpected costs can arise during the repair. Always clarify pricing before the technician begins work.
  • Potential Delays: Scheduling and repair appointments can sometimes experience delays, especially during peak seasons.

H2: Alternatives to Lowe's ComeService

If you're dissatisfied with Lowe's ComeService or looking for alternatives, consider these options:

  • Manufacturer's Warranty: Check your appliance's warranty information. Manufacturers often offer repair services or authorized repair centers.
  • Independent Appliance Repair Companies: Search online for local, independent appliance repair companies. Read reviews and compare pricing before making a decision.
  • Other Retailers: Other home improvement retailers or appliance stores may also offer repair services.

H2: How to Maximize Your Lowe's ComeService Experience

  • Read Reviews: Before scheduling a repair, take some time to look at online reviews of Lowe's ComeService in your area.
  • Detailed Description: Be as clear and descriptive as possible when explaining the problem with your appliance.
  • Clarify Pricing: Ask for a price estimate upfront, and make sure you understand all charges before the technician begins work.
  • Documentation: Keep all documentation, including invoices and warranty information, for future reference.
